Patient administration underpins the patient journey and supports clinical teams in delivering high quality patient care and can make a real difference to the patient experience. Effective and efficient patient administration supports management through ensuring a high standard of data quality and by making the best use of capacity and resources.
The post holder has responsibility for the provision of a professional, comprehensive service for patients and members of the department and managing the patient pathway in line with the Oxford County Council policy.

To maintain, train and develop the administrative staff, as delegated by the Administration Manager, to provide a responsive, Qualitative, and professional operational service making the best use of the resources at the department’s disposal. To provide a comprehensive administrative and secretarial support to the Adult Social and Community Services Team (Social Work Team) based at the John Radcliffe Hospital, Churchill Hospital, and the Horton Hospital.
To take responsibility for keeping up to date with team and service developments and personal development needs

The Trust comprises four hospitals - the John Radcliffe Hospital, Churchill Hospital and Nuffield Orthopaedic Centre in Headington and the Horton General Hospital in Banbury.

Our values, standards and behaviours define the quality of clinical care we offer and the professional relationships we make with our patients, colleagues and the wider community. We call this Delivering Compassionate Excellence and its focus is on our values of compassion, respect, learning, delivery, improvement and excellence. These values put patients at the heart of what we do and underpin the quality healthcare we would like for ourselves or a member of our family.
